Transaction 680c70fe0358d38ea9e58779332fd5887d0a3306cb59d81c3cabb1632b7b0b35

1 Input
2 Outputs
  • 680c70fe0358d38ea9e58779332fd5887d0a3306cb59d81c3cabb1632b7b0b35:0
  • value  4387473
    address  39xr847V8gKKquP5Xga9WuLRuuBYRt9kE9
  • 680c70fe0358d38ea9e58779332fd5887d0a3306cb59d81c3cabb1632b7b0b35:1
  • value  57917330
    address  19kv66q4K1nJHjt8WThZ4RiFoHDTeeETdy